The tailoring courses covers the area of design, pattern making, cutting, fitting and the final stitching of the tailored items including jackets, trousers, skirts, lined shift dresses and waistcoats. At your local community or technical college you may find tailoring courses as part of a continuing education program. In these courses you may learn basic tailoring techniques or how to tailor different types of garments, such as men's suits. The SRA course is a flexible modular programme and comprises four advanced study modules in pattern cutting, fitting and remarking; trousers and waistcoat making; and coat/jacket making.
